Fox News’ Kat Timpf Provides Candid Health Update from Hospital Following Cancer Surgery
Fox News star Kat Timpf shared an inspiring and humorous health update from her hospital bed following a successful double mastectomy, part of her treatment for stage zero breast cancer. Timpf, known for her comedic and outspoken presence on television, revealed her diagnosis just hours before giving birth to her first child with husband Cameron Friscia in late February.
On Thursday, Timpf took to Instagram to update her followers about her post-operation condition, sharing a candid photograph of herself in a hospital gown with hospital-issued socks. Maintaining her signature humor, Timpf joked about the aftermath of her surgery, saying, “They’re honestly not much smaller than they were before I got pregnant,” referencing her breast size.
The heartfelt post quickly generated a flood of supportive messages from fans, colleagues, and followers, all sending their love, encouragement, and prayers for a speedy recovery. One supporter wrote, “Prayers to you. You’re such an inspiration to all of us,” while another echoed, “Sending you wishes for a speedy recovery!”
Several individuals shared their personal experiences, highlighting empathy and camaraderie within the community. One comment stood out, resonating deeply with many: “I hope you feel better really soon. The double mastectomy was physically the ‘easiest’ of all the operations I had to have because of cancer. It was emotionally a total mind f. I’m praying for you.”
Just days before, Timpf had posted another candid message with her characteristic wit, showcasing a picture outside Memorial Sloan Kettering Cancer Center. She humorously detailed her ambitious recovery goals, quipping, “Once I recover from childbirth, my mole removal scars heal, I get a double mastectomy, get rid of my cancer, have breast reconstruction surgery & am physically capable of getting back in the gym it’s OVER FOR U B***HEZ #MILF.”
This refreshingly honest and humorous approach resonated with thousands, including colleagues from Fox News. Her co-host, Greg Gutfeld, encouraged her, commenting, “You’re kicking ass Kat! We’re all missing you here.” Many followers praised her courage and positive outlook, with comments like, “Fiercely hilarious and so courageous—be strong, can’t wait for your return,” and “You got this. You are incredibly strong and don’t you forget that!”
Since her diagnosis, Timpf has remained transparent about her journey, openly discussing the emotional and physical challenges she faces. Shortly after discovering her illness, she reassured fans through a social media post that her cancer was stage zero and that her doctor was confident it hadn’t spread further.
Expressing gratitude for her supportive medical team, Timpf noted that humor and compassion from hospital staff significantly eased the emotional toll of her diagnosis and treatment.
With this latest update, Kat Timpf continues to inspire and uplift others with her courage, humor, and unyielding strength. As she embarks on this challenging journey, her openness and resilience have fostered a powerful community of support and hope, ensuring she won’t face this battle alone.
